EPL: Liverpool suffer third successive loss as Estevao strikes late for Chelsea

Brazilian wonderkid Estevao’s first Chelsea goal inflicted a third consecutive defeat on Liverpool on Saturday, allowing Arsenal to go top of the Premier League after beating West Ham 2-0.

After winning their opening seven games of the season in all competitions, Liverpool have suffered a nightmare week to leave Arne Slot plenty to ponder over the international break.

Injury-hit Chelsea were well worthy of a dramatic 2-1 win at Stamford Bridge to end their three-game winless run in the Premier League.

One-time Liverpool target Moises Caicedo blasted the Blues into a half-time lead with a blistering strike into the top corner on 14 minutes.

Alexander Isak’s £125 million ($168 million) move to Liverpool last month broke Caicedo’s record as the most expensive Premier League player of all-time.

The Swedish striker is still yet to score a league goal but his deft touch teed up Cody Gakpo to equalise just after the hour mark.

However, Chelsea were not to be denied as Estevao slid in at the far post to meet Marc Cucurella’s cross deep into stoppage time, sparking wild celebrations from manager Enzo Maresca who was shown a red card for sprinting down the touchline.

Liverpool now trail Arsenal by one point, while Chelsea edge up to sixth.

Tottenham showed their newfound defensive resolve under Thomas Frank to end Leeds’ year-long unbeaten league run at Elland Road with a 2-1 victory.

Mohammed Kudus’ first goal for Spurs secured all three points after Noah Okafor cancelled out Mathys Tel’s opener for the visitors.
